[Until a squeezed log is made]
(1) Tree planting / undergrowth mowing (2) Pruning / thinning (3) Strangulation (Chopstick-shaped batten is wrapped around a growing trunk with a wire, etc. Add a squeeze pattern)
④ Logging / withering leaves ⑤ Carrying out from the mountain ⑥ Peeling / cracking the back ⑦ Polishing work <polishing the surface to make it smooth>
⑧ Sun-dried / cold-exposed <brings out the luster>
⑨ Naturally dried soil wall <Dry for over a year to condition the wood>

* About back splitting Back splitting is a cut made in the core of an undried coniferous tree <sugi or cypress>. It has been used in pillars such as the Imperial Palace and shrines since ancient times. Since the trees are also alive, they will crack as they dry. Back splitting is a device to minimize cracks on the surface, but cracks still occur.
